Allow me to be the first to answer your question: No. There is no recommended profession. Every profession has it's own strengths and weaknesses. Having said that; the developers have suggested that people start out playing a warrior. Warriors are fairly simple to get the hang of, and notoriously difficult to kill. The epitome of easy to learn impossible to master, they have quite a shallow learning curve especially for PvE leading them to being a great starter class for people new to the game. Well, elementalists have the weakest armor in game, warriors have the strongest. Rangers (or rogues) have the second strongest. Just going by base armor levels here...
A good bet, after you have read a few guides, is pick what you want to be and try it out. Then try out some others, it's easy to do No one class is better than another. Me? I STILL can't pick a class, heh, I like them all. |

Being new to Guild Wars (this past weekend was my first time playing) I found that the Ranger/Warrior combinaton was a good first pick. You are able to attack from a distance with your bow and pet but are able to do some damage in a melee fight also. This worked for me and is just a suggestion.
